What are some common challenges faced by Freelance Google Workspace Admins when managing multiple client environments?

Freelance Google Workspace Admins often juggle the unique configurations, security settings, and user policies of several clients simultaneously. This can lead to challenges such as keeping track of different administrative consoles, responding promptly to urgent support requests across time zones, and ensuring consistent application of best practices for each organization. Effective documentation, strong communication, and the use of secure, organized workflows are essential to manage these complexities and maintain high-quality service.

What does a Freelance Google Workspace Admin do?

A Freelance Google Workspace Admin is a specialist who manages and supports Google Workspace (formerly G Suite) for businesses or organizations on a contract basis. Their responsibilities include setting up user accounts, managing access and security settings, troubleshooting issues, and ensuring that Google Workspace tools like Gmail, Drive, and Meet run smoothly. They work remotely or on-site as needed, often providing flexible support to multiple clients. Freelance admins help businesses optimize their use of Google Workspace and keep their data secure.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Freelance Google Workspace Admin,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Freelance Google Workspace Admin, you need expertise in Google Workspace (formerly G Suite) administration, strong troubleshooting abilities, and a solid understanding of IT security protocols. Familiarity with the Google Admin Console, user and group management tools, and relevant certifications like Google Workspace Administrator Certification are highly valuable. Excellent communication, problem-solving, and time management skills help in managing client expectations and resolving issues efficiently. These skills and qualifications are essential to ensure secure, smooth, and scalable collaboration environments for diverse clients.

Job description

Dark Wolf is looking for a Google Workspace Engineer who is interested in working in a fast-paced environment supporting and maintaining a large-scale Google Workspace environment for a DoD customer. The successful candidate will work in collaboration with the customer's security team and will be responsible for implementing security best practices for Google Workspace to include designing and architecting solutions to secure services, monitoring Workspace services, and responding to incidents. This position will also offer the opportunity for the successful candidate to expand their role into greater responsibilities such as Cloud and Platform Security Engineering.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Administer all services within the Workspace suite: Gmail, Drive, Docs, etc.
  • Design and implement data loss prevention (DLP) controls for Workspace content
  • Implement Gmail filtering controls to detect and quarantine sensitive content
  • Perform Incident response on across all Workspace services
  • Document and present security best practices and designs to Customer stakeholders

Required Qualifications:

  • 5+ years of System Administration experience for Education, Enterprise or Federal Government customers
  • 2+ System Administration experience for Google Workspace or similar SaaS office suite platform (e.g. Microsoft 365)
  • Experience supporting user requests and troubleshooting issues
  • Experience with DoD/DISA cybersecurity policies
  • US Citizenship and the ability to obtain a Secret security clearance

Desired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's Degree in Computer Science of related field
  • Professional Google Workspace Administrator Certificate
  • Experience operating and maintaining systems on Google Cloud Platform (GCP), Amazon Web Services (AWS), or Microsoft Azure
  • Knowledge of the Risk Management Framework (RMF) accreditation process and security requirements
  • Knowledge of Google Apps Manager (GAM)
